Some of the key areas of responsibility include:
- Assist in successfully managing the team ensuring all Key Performance indicators (KPI) are met
- Conduct regular one-to-one meetings with team members each period, identifying areas for improvement and escalating any concerns to management.
- Collaborate with the Team Support Manager to deliver training sessions and address performance or knowledge gaps.
- Keep both yourself and the team up to date with product knowledge, system enhancements, NHS developments, company procedures, and complaint processes.
- Inspire and motivate the team to consistently deliver outstanding customer service, providing coaching and support, including handling calls when necessary
- Complete quality checks, reviewing outcomes with staff and offering constructive feedback for improvement.
- Ability to work well as part of a team but also to work under own initiative
- Trustworthy, honest, committed and to work with integrity
- Strong verbal and written communication skills with the ability to communicate at various levels, internally and externally
